Assistant Director for Development

Allison Sawczyn is responsible for assisting the Executive Vice President with all matters of enhancing strategic planning initiatives, including board development, marketing campaigns, and fundraising-with an emphasis on corporate and major gifts.

Prior to joining the ADDF, Ms. Sawczyn spent six years working in the Development offices of The Metropolitan Museum of Art and the American Museum of Natural History, respectively, specializing in corporate sponsorships.

Ms. Sawczyn is an accomplished fundraiser, whose focus on engaging corporations, major gifts, boards of trustees, and VIP membership groups has lended an expertise towards cultivating and stewarding up to multi-million dollar grants from Fortune 500 companies and individuals.  Previous to this, Ms. Sawczyn worked for several years for the Forbes family, overseeing a myriad of curatorial, advertising, and licensing projects for their private art collection and acting as external liasion with Forbes Magazine’s constituents for the purpose of business development.

Beginning her career working in the press office of Sotheby’s in London, England, Ms. Sawczyn was granted a BS with honors in Organizational Communication, Learning, and Design with a concentration in Advertising, Public Relations, and Art History from the Roy H. Park School of Communications, Ithaca College.
